mtDNA tests: these tests focus on mitochondrial DNA, that's accustomed to trace matrilineal ancestors as it’s handed nearly unchanged from moms to their young children.

Y-DNA tests: these tests center on the Y chromosome (if male), that's used to trace patrilineal ancestors mainly because it’s passed basically unchanged from fathers to sons.
